Industrial painting certification and professional painting courses play a crucial role in working out and development of people seeking to excel in the field of painting, particularly in industrial settings where precision, efficiency, and safety are paramount. These comprehensive training programs cover a wide range of topics and techniques, providing participants with the data and skills essential to thrive in this specialized industry. One of the key aspects of industrial painting certification is the knowledge of surface preparation techniques. Proper surface preparation is essential for ensuring the adhesion and longevity of paint coatings. Participants in these certification programs learn about various types of surface preparation, including sandblasting, power washing, and chemical cleaning. Additionally they gain on the job experience in assessing surface conditions and determining the absolute most appropriate preparation methods for different substrates and environmental conditions. Another critical aspect of professional painting courses is the mastery of paint application techniques. Paint sprayer training courses, for instance, concentrate on teaching participants how to make use of spray equipment effectively and efficiently. Students find out about the various kinds of spray guns, tips, and nozzles, as well as the correct processes for achieving uniform coverage and consistent finish.

Additionally, trainees are instructed on the significance of maintaining proper air pressure, paint viscosity, and spray distance to optimize performance and minimize waste. Moreover, industrial painting certification programs emphasize the choice and application of coatings that force away corrosion, rust, and other types of damage. Participants find out about the properties and characteristics of numerous paint formulations, in addition to the factors that influence coating performance, such as substrate type, exposure conditions, and environmental factors. In addition they gain insight into the latest advancements in coating technology, including low VOC (volatile organic compound) formulations and environmentally friendly alternatives. Along with technical skills, professional painting courses also address safety considerations, particularly for working at heights or in confined spaces. Rope access services training, like, equips participants with the information and skills essential to safely navigate and work in challenging environments, such as for instance tall buildings, bridges, and industrial facilities. Participants understand proper harness and rigging techniques, as well as emergency procedures and rescue protocols. Furthermore, industrial painting certification programs cover regulatory compliance and industry standards, ensuring that participants are well versed in applicable regulations and best practices. Topics such as for instance hazardous materials handling, waste disposal, and environmental protection are addressed to ensure that painters operate safely and responsibly.
